Huge Chunk Of Ceiling Fell And Destroyed Seats Just Hours Before Indiana Basketball Game

Feb 19, 2014, 19:16 IST

An 8-foot long piece of metal fell from the ceiling of Indiana University's Assembly Hall and destroyed several seats just hours before the Hoosiers were to play Iowa in men's basketball.

The game was postponed. Indiana athletic director Fred Glass told ESPN that the early speculation is that the accident was weather related but did not elaborate.
